Devolution of fracking laws to the Scottish Parliament

Additional Information

The UK Government have announced that they are to remove the rights of householders to object to oil and gas drilling and hydraulic fracturing beneath their homes.

This will include householders in Scotland, and comes after 99 per cent of respondents to the UK Government consultation on the proposals objecting to them.

We the undersigned petition the UK Government to facilitate the devolution of the relevant powers so that Scotland can make its own decision on this serious matter.
